Analysis

The most recent figure for electricity generation in United Kingdom is 292.31 terawatt-hours, measured in 2025.

The figure is up 2.9% on the previous year and down 13.7% over ten years.

Over the whole period, electricity generation in United Kingdom peaked at 398.35 terawatt-hours in 2005 and was at its lowest, 3.6 terawatt-hours, in 1921.

United Kingdom ranks 17th of 214 countries on this measure, in the top 10%.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

Averages by decade

DecadeAverage LowestHighest Years
1920s 6.15 terawatt-hours 3.6 terawatt-hours 9.76 terawatt-hours 10
1930s 16.55 terawatt-hours 10.26 terawatt-hours 25.02 terawatt-hours 10
1940s 36.61 terawatt-hours 27.21 terawatt-hours 45.82 terawatt-hours 10
1950s 73.06 terawatt-hours 51.47 terawatt-hours 98.94 terawatt-hours 10
1960s 162.94 terawatt-hours 116.96 terawatt-hours 206.37 terawatt-hours 10
1970s 239.25 terawatt-hours 215.76 terawatt-hours 264.34 terawatt-hours 10
1980s 276.34 terawatt-hours 242.48 terawatt-hours 314.58 terawatt-hours 10
1990s 338.32 terawatt-hours 319.75 terawatt-hours 368.15 terawatt-hours 10
2000s 389.94 terawatt-hours 376.76 terawatt-hours 398.35 terawatt-hours 10
2010s 348.75 terawatt-hours 327.19 terawatt-hours 382.06 terawatt-hours 10
2020s 301.96 terawatt-hours 284.16 terawatt-hours 324.58 terawatt-hours 6
